Family Participation Requirements

Family

With your assistance, we are anticipating another wonderful ECHO year! ECHO is a true cooperative, and could not function without the help and assistance of the parents as working, positive classroom aides.

Attendance at the Parent Night meeting is mandatory for enrollment in ECHO.

Please remember that ECHO is not a drop-off for your children and you must remain on the premises until children are dismissed to class (9:25 AM). We would encourage you to fellowship with other parents and appreciate your willingness to participate in each ECHO day.

ECHO classes end at 12:30 PM. Please arrive by 12:25 PM to pick up your children.

Please read the aiding sections carefully and come prepared to help minister to our children and our teachers.

A parent from each family will aide in the classroom for 6 - 7 days. You will stay in the same class for an entire 3-week rotation. This will allow you to better assist the teachers in your assigned classroom.

General Duties

Please come prepared each work day to:

  • Help set up the classroom before ECHO starts for the day, stay in room to help the teacher when she/he arrives.
  • After classes are over clean the room, vacuum, break down long tables, stack chairs.
  • Take roll in each class.
  • Help control behavior in and out of the classroom (Please review the Discipline Policy for more information).
  • Assist the teacher whenever possible, before, during, and after class.
  • Help the younger students to their next classes.

Work Hours

Aides are to sign in on the ECHO Aides' Roster at the front table no later than 9:00 AM on the ECHO clock and be prepared to stay until 1:00 PM. Please stay until all rooms are restored to their proper order, the board member on duty has released you, and you have signed out on the ECHO Aides Roster.

Check-in

You will need to pick up the Aide Notebook for your scheduled class at the front table after you sign in each week and return it at the end of each day. These notebooks contain important information such as classroom set-up, attendance sheets, discipline forms, tardy forms, and Student Award slips. If it was necessary for you to fill out a discipline form, please alert the board member on duty. On the first Friday of each 3-week rotation there will be a short briefing of aide duties and an assigning of set-up requirements. At this time, the Set Up Coordinator will give you a quick briefing of your duties and answer any questions.

Fines

A $10 fine will be charged to any aide who is late for a scheduled or traded work day. If you are unable to work, it is your duty to trade with another parent. A phone list with scheduled work days will be available to assist you in finding a substitute. A $25 fine will be charged for a no-show. If a parent is persistently late or fails to show, the board will look at that family’s continued participation in ECHO.

Nursery

Nursery is available to Teacher’s Aides for their own children ages 4 and under on their scheduled work days only. You must make other arrangements for school-aged children and day care children not enrolled in ECHO. Children may not be dropped off in the nursery and left if the parent is not working as an aide that day.

Duty Assignments

You will have the opportunity to pick your own aide assignments during aide sign-up. We will notify you when aide sign-up opens. Slots will be filled on a first-come, first-served basis. We encourage you to sign-up soon after this opens. If you have a child in the nursery or enrolled in Preschool, please plan on working in that position for a three-week rotation.
